What is Cucumber Chili Oil?
Cucumber chili oil is a dish that combines thinly sliced cucumbers with a homemade chili oil dressing. The chili oil is typically made by infusing oil with dried chili flakes, garlic, ginger, and other aromatic spices. This dressing is then poured over fresh cucumbers, creating a dish that’s both refreshing and spicy.
The origins of this dish can be traced back to Asian cuisines, where chili oil is a staple condiment. Over time, creative chefs began experimenting with different ingredients, leading to the creation of cucumber chili oil. It’s now a popular dish in many households and restaurants, appreciated for its simplicity and bold flavors.

Ingredients You’ll Need
Before you start making cucumber chili oil, gather the following ingredients:
For the Cucumbers:
- 2 medium-sized cucumbers
- 1 teaspoon salt (for drawing out moisture)
For the Chili Oil:
- ½ cup neutral oil (like vegetable or canola oil)
- 2 tablespoons dried chili flakes
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on ginger, grated
- 1 teaspoon Sichuan peppercorns (optional, for added heat)
- 1 teaspoon soy sauce
- 1 teaspoon sugar
These ingredients are easy to find and can be adjusted to suit your taste preferences.

Step-by-Step Guide to Making Cucumber Chili Oil
Follow these simple steps to create your own cucumber chili oil:
Step 1: Prepare the Cucumbers
Peel the cucumbers and slice them thinly. Place the slices in a bowl and sprinkle with salt. Let them sit for 10 minutes to draw out excess moisture. Pat them dry with a paper towel.
Step 2: Make the Chili Oil
Heat the oil in a small pan over medium heat. Add the garlic, ginger, and Sichuan peppercorns. Cook until fragrant, about 2 minutes. Stir in the dried chili flakes and cook for another 30 seconds. Remove from heat and add soy sauce and sugar.
Step 3: Combine and Serve
Place the cucumber slices in a serving bowl and pour the chili oil over them. Toss gently to combine. Let it sit for 5 minutes before serving to allow the flavors to meld.
Tips for Perfect Cucumber Chili Oil
Here are some expert tips to ensure your cucumber chili oil turns out perfectly:
- Use Fresh Ingredients: Fresh cucumbers and high-quality chili flakes make a big difference in flavor.
- Adjust Spice Levels: Add more or fewer chili flakes depending on your tolerance for heat.
- Don’t Overcook the Oil: Overheating can make the chili flakes bitter, so cook them just until fragrant.
- Let It Rest: Allowing the dish to sit for a few minutes before serving enhances the flavors.

Storage and Shelf Life
Cucumber chili oil is best enjoyed fresh, but you can store leftovers in the refrigerator for up to 2 days. Keep the cucumbers and chili oil separate to prevent sogginess, and combine them just before serving.
The chili oil itself can be stored in an airtight container for up to 1 month. Always use clean utensils when handling stored chili oil to avoid contamination.
